Transaction 523495048301a14eaf79bbc9a767f101c95d410927a383464423443e42128bcd
1 Input
1 Output
-
523495048301a14eaf79bbc9a767f101c95d410927a383464423443e42128bcd:0
- value
- 22990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 11b858fa1b014fe1cfdac54447948258dfeb774a OP_EQUALVERIFY OP_CHECKSIG
- address
- 12chKxNCA9yeY9K85mbTohg1ubrMCUTnRU